I sat down again with Ed Mendoza, this time in the mountains of Colombia.
The last time Ed joined me on the podcast, we were in Australia. This time, we met on Colombian land, surrounded by mountains, water, ceremony, and conversation about what it means to live in a good way.
Thanks for reading The Way Of Life! This post is public so feel free to share it.
Ed speaks from a life shaped by farming, ceremony, hardship, family, prayer, and deep relationship with Mother Earth. In this episode, we talk about staying connected to the land, moving through hard times, believing in yourself, learning from ceremony, and remembering that even simple acts of kindness can help make the world better.
Now living between Arizona and Mexico, Ed continues to carry ceremonial work locally and internationally, sharing from lived experience rather than theory.
This conversation is a reminder to breathe, stay humble, return to nature, and keep going.
